Common Questions About Trading View Strategy

How does pattern recognition translate into real trading decisions?
The strategy centers on identifying recurring structural shifts—such as breakouts, reversion to mean, or momentum spikes—using key chart formations. These patterns are not proof of movement, but indicators that price may be entering new regimes. Traders use these insights to adjust stop placement, position sizing, and timing, enhancing risk-adjusted setups.
